Pleasanton, CA — The Bosch Rexroth Corporation announced it will provide precision linear motion solutions for a leading semiconductor automation company located in Fremont, CA, with manufacturing in Asia.
Under the agreement implemented from its Technology Center West in Pleasanton, CA, Bosch Rexroth will supply Ball Rail linear motion guides with cleanroom greases. Also in the testing stage are precision rolled ball screws.
The customer, who makes automation equipment for semiconductor, flat panel display and related industries, prefers to remain anonymous for proprietary reasons.
Lisa Cavolina, Key Account Manager at the Bosch Rexroth Technology Center West, said the relationship was solidified earlier this year after a team had worked together to make what she called the “global handshake” possible.
“When we entered the relationship, our customer was in the midst of an aggressive cost-reduction program which we were able to support by meeting their cost models and product improvement goals,” Cavolina said. “Bosch Rexroth has capabilities all around the world, so we are providing engineering services, product samples and testing from both California and our Charlotte, NC facility, while Bosch Rexroth in Asia supplies the components and local support for the customer’s manufacturing located there. It really is a seamless and ideal relationship,” she added.
